Synopsys Buys Glasgow EDA Startup to Boost Growth

Synopsys, Inc. announced it has completed the acquisition of Gold Standard Simulations Ltd. (GSS), a leading provider of TCAD and EDA simulation solutions for design technology co-optimization (DTCO) of advanced process nodes. The acquisition of GSS supports the Synopsys TCAD strategy to offer a comprehensive solution to reduce development time and cost for advanced node development by enabling the evaluation and selection of process, device and materials options in the pre-wafer research phases of development.

 

Gold Standard Simulations Ltd (GSS) started  in 2010 with £720,000 seed funding and support from Scottish Enterprise to commercialise more than 20 years of research in modelling and simulation of advanced transistors and circuits for semiconductor microchips.

 

GSS was created by Professor Asen Asenov, James Watt Chair in Electrical Engineering in the College of Science and Engineering, with support from the university and Scottish Enterprise. Professor Asenov is one of the world’s leading device modelling experts and leader of the acclaimed Glasgow Device Modelling Group (DMG).

 

Professor Asenov said: “We are delighted that the GSS vision and technology can be brought to the next level by the best and the brightest player on the EDA arena amplifying its impact on the semiconductor industry.” “The GSS team, which will be incorporated into the Synopsys technology CAD (TCAD) group and will remain in Scotland, provides jobs for University of Glasgow PhD students and former Post-Doctoral Research Associates (PDRAs) — all of whom are former members of the DMG.”
